Legiterally

legiterally (adverb) : early-21c., "in a legitimate and literal sense, according to the genuine, real, exact meaning of the word or words used (originally in reference to an anonymous and spontaneous fusion of the words literally and legitimately). Combination of "literally" and "legitimately". Seemingly more precise and displaying a greater sense of "reality" than either "legitimate" or "literal".
"It is meant to be taken legiterally when stated that there are 10 to the power of 100 to the power of 100 ((10^100)^100) particles in the entire universe."

"It's legiterally impossible to go skinny-dipping in a volcano; your body would skip across the surface of the lava and explode from the extreme heat vaporizing the water inside of you."
